See the file "COPYING" in the main directory of this archive for more details. Tight version of memset for the case of just clearing a page. It turns out that having the alloco's spaced out slightly due to the increment/branch pair causes them to contend less for access to the cache. Similarly, keeping the stores apart from the allocos causes less contention. => Do two separate loops. Do multiple stores per loop to amortise the increment/branch cost a little. Parameters: r2 : source effective address (start of page) Always clears 4096 bytes.
